Elderly man robbed inside elevator

RMA 816-17 ROBBERY 114 PCT 3-25-17 (1)An 83-year-old Astoria man was robbed inside the elevator of his own residential building on Saturday afternoon, according to authorities.

Police say that at approximately 6:42 p.m., two men got inside an apartment building near 21st Street and 36th Avenue. They followed the 83-year-old victim inside an elevator at the lobby.

Once the door closed, police say one of the suspects showed a knife and told the victim, “Don’t make a noise.” Meanwhile, the second suspect took the man’s cell phone and $20.

They left the apartment building. Luckily, the victim walked away physically unscathed.
